This is a down stream image of glade creek from the grist mill. This mountain feed creek has extremely cold water year around. The rocks are craggy and slippery making it easy for a person to fall in. The creek itself has some very deep pockets in it but overall is not but a few feet deep.
Christopher Flees of Flees Photos is an Internationally Published Photographer, Art Promoter, Artist, and Producer of Man Cave, She Shed, Home and Business decor. "He entered the art of photography and photo processing at the age of 13 in a studio owned by a family friend and professional photographer. He started out working in the darkroom developing and processing portfolio images for models. A quick study he transitioned out of the darkroom and onto the studio floor working with the models and composing image for their portfolios. After several years of studio work Chris left the studio, desiring a change in his career direction. He transitioned his career toward fine art landscape photography.
